Purpose of the Job
As Deputy Events Coordinator, you will support the planning and operations of events under the direction of the Events Coordinator. You will assist in ensuring the smooth day-to-day running of activities, staffing, and customer experiences throughout seasonal periods.

Key Responsibilities
• Assist in overseeing seasonal and event staffing, ensuring all activities are appropriately timed, communicated, and clicker counted.
• Support the coordination of event logistics, ensuring areas are appropriately staffed and resourced each day.
• Assist with issuing and recording of event uniforms, radios, clickers, and other necessary equipment.
• Maintain a visible presence on-site, assisting staff and providing customer service as needed.
• Collect and compile feedback data for review after each event period.
Other Duties
• Provide administrative assistance for customer service and operational meetings (including note-taking).
• Assist in organising social events for staff.
• Support the investigation of event-related incidents and first aid incidents.
Health and Safety Responsibilities
• Ensure adherence to Health & Safety procedures and COSHH regulations regarding equipment, materials, and general safety.
• Help monitor staff compliance with policies and procedures.
• Assist with updates and improvements to operational procedures and risk assessments.
• Support routine risk assessments, accident reports, and incident management procedures.
• Act as an appointed First Aider when required.
Quality Standards & People Management
• Ensure staff are informed about event schedules.
• Help ensure staff adhere to uniform and appearance standards.
• Support recruitment, inductions, and training of seasonal staff.
• Assist in maintaining staff performance and engagement during events.
